'Big Bang Theory' to Feature Local Actress Thursday
Nazareth-area actress Kate Micucci can be seen on the popular CBS comedy 'Big Bang Theory.'
Lehigh Valley actress Kate Micucci has been cast in a recurring role on "The Big Bang Theory" as "a potential love interest for the confirmed bachelor Raj," according to the Hollywood Reporter and Wikipedia.
The Hollywood Reporter says she will make her debut on the Valentine's Day episode of the CBS comedy.

Born in New Jersey and raised in the Nazareth area, Micucci appeared in five episodes of "Scrubs," is a recurring character on "Raising Hope," and has had guest roles on "Malcolm in the Middle," "'Til Death" and " How I Met Your Mother."
Micucci has appeared in ten movies and performs in Los Angeles as half of the musical duo "Garfunkel and Oates." She also performs the musical-comedy act "Playin' with Micucci" at the Steve Allen Theater in L.A.
